Defensoría del Consumidor activates price inspection plan in light of 20% increase in minimum wage

Written by Alondra Gutiérrez

In view of the announcement of a 20% increase in the minimum wage made by the President of the Republic, the Defensoría del Consumidor (DC)) is activating the national inspection plan to avoid speculation and hoarding of products of the basic food basket.

The deployment and surveillance of the Defensoría del Consumidor (DC) shall also contribute to the lowering and stability of prices, likewise the monitoring of prices of basic products allows determining or establishing abusive practices such as the use of maneuvers or artifices for the achievement of unjustified price hikes.

"This is our commitment. We do not want certain groups to take advantage of this situation and generate a speculative wave against the daily economy of millions of salvadorans", said Ricardo Salazar, president of the Defensoría del Consumidor (DC).

The Defensoría del Consumidor warns that in case of identifying arbitrary price increases or restriction of sale of products in the national market, it will act and pursue illegal practices with all legal resources allowed by the current legal framework.

In case abusive practices to the detriment of consumers are detected, the sanctioning procedure will be activated with all the rigor of the law and will be coordinated with the Fiscalía General de la República (FGR) in order to prosecute ex officio the conducts and practices that could constitute crimes related "to the market, free competition and consumer protection" such as hoarding, or false propagation, according to articles 233, 236 and 237 of the Penal Code.

According to article 18, paragraph h, of the Ley de Protección al Consumidor (LPC ), such practice constitutes a very serious infraction. According to art. 44, letter e, of the CPL, this practice may be sanctioned with up to US$500 monthly minimum wages in the industry.
